Manx Care says the number of people not attending appointments is continuing to affect GP surgeries across the Island.
There were 993 'Did Not Attends' in total in July, followed by 944 in August.
Peel was one of the worst affected surgeries, with 129 people missing appointments in July, and 125 the following month.
People are reminded to cancel their appointments if they can no longer make it, so it can be offered to someone else - information on how to cancel can be found on the Manx Care website.
